WI Court of Appeals – District I
Case Name: State of Wisconsin v. Lamonte W. Moore
Case No.: 2017AP1120-CR
Officials: Kessler, P.J., Brennan and Brash, JJ.
Focus: Jury Instructions
A jury convicted Lamonte W. Moore of felony murder. See WIS. STAT. § 940.03 (2013-14). Moore appeals from the judgment of conviction and from the order denying his postconviction motion. Moore maintains that he is entitled to a new trial based on the trial court’s failure to provide the jury with an instruction on accomplice testimony and trial counsel’s ineffective assistance for failing to request the instruction. See WIS JI—CRIMINAL 245. We disagree and affirm.
